Output 8355aefafb1ba9b082c0a247bc29ed83b70e37205701379011c1a69716ace6c8:11

value
148680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6699b945f59576abd3ade7d72faf671cd8e5a647 OP_EQUAL
address
MHFfJueLBfsSC1MarrNpucn5WVasMA5j2r
transaction
8355aefafb1ba9b082c0a247bc29ed83b70e37205701379011c1a69716ace6c8
spent
true